In this paper, the newly ascertained analytical solutions of the (2+1)-dimensional Heisenberg ferromagnetic spin chain equation has been studied. The novel analytical method, namely the modified Khater method, has been effectively used to get these new exact soliton solutions. The outcomes permit different wave solutions in different conditions such as singular wave, anti-kink, kink, bright, dark and anti-peakon solutions. Furthermore, the dynamics of the achieved solutions have been presented and analysed through three-dimensional (3D) graphical representation and two-dimensional (2D) graphical representation. This ensures the productivity of the proposed method.
